Output de3faf7f9d89bb0071e385b759dc7886e64d5a5bcee38447144d65d76b1c3f13:3

value
317273
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db9512fab7671216d44f2dbe9f45f45ad3b5ba66 OP_EQUAL
address
3Mi4VQaULaX6urAcLNFXLkYJNmCaHgjBsb
transaction
de3faf7f9d89bb0071e385b759dc7886e64d5a5bcee38447144d65d76b1c3f13
spent
true